مرحبًا بك في Learn Harness Engineering
Learn Harness Engineering هو مساق مخصص لهندسة وكلاء البرمجة بالذكاء الاصطناعي. درسنا و لخصنا مجموعة من أكثر نظريات وممارسات Harness Engineering تقدمًا في الصناعة. تشمل مراجعنا الأساسية:
- OpenAI: Harness engineering: leveraging Codex in an agent-first world
- Anthropic: Effective harnesses for long-running agents
- Anthropic: Harness design for long-running application development
- Awesome Harness Engineering
من خلال تصميم البيئة، وإدارة الحالة، والتحقق، وأنظمة التحكم بطريقة منهجية، يوضح هذا المساق كيف تجعل أدوات البرمجة الوكيلية مثل Codex و Claude Code موثوقة فعليًا. ستتعلم كيف تبني الميزات، وتصلح الأخطاء، وتؤتمت مهام التطوير عبر تقييد مساعد البرمجة بالذكاء الاصطناعي بقواعد وحدود صريحة.
ابدأ
اختر مسار التعلم المناسب لك. ينقسم المساق إلى محاضرات نظرية، ومشاريع عملية، ومكتبة موارد جاهزة للنسخ.
المحاضرات
افهم لماذا تفشل النماذج القوية أحيانًا، وتعلم النظرية وراء harnesses الفعالة.
المشاريع
تدريب عملي على بناء بيئة وكيلية موثوقة من الصفر.
مكتبة الموارد
قوالب جاهزة للنسخ مثل AGENTS.md و feature_list.json لاستخدامها في مستودعاتك.
الآلية الأساسية للـ harness
الـ harness لا "يجعل النموذج أذكى"؛ بل ينشئ نظام عمل مغلق الحلقة للنموذج. يمكنك فهم التدفق الأساسي من خلال هذا المخطط:
ما الذي ستتعلمه
هذه بعض المفاهيم الأساسية التي ستتقنها:
- تقييد سلوك الوكيل بقواعد وحدود صريحة.
- الحفاظ على السياق عبر المهام الطويلة ومتعددة الجلسات.
- منع الوكلاء من إعلان النجاح مبكرًا.
- التحقق من العمل باستخدام اختبارات pipeline كاملة ومراجعة ذاتية.
- جعل runtime قابلًا للملاحظة وأسهل في التصحيح.
الخطوات التالية
بعد فهم المفاهيم الأساسية، تساعدك هذه الأدلة على التعمق:
- المحاضرة 01: لماذا تفشل الوكلاء القادرة أحيانًا: ابدأ بالنظرية وراء harness engineering.
- المشروع 01: baseline مقابل harness بسيط: نفذ أول مهمة عملية حقيقية.
- القوالب: احصل على حزمة harness بسيطة لاستخدامها في مشاريعك.